以前没有接触过CXF,项目需要学习,从网上各种找资料加上项目的实践,不断垒字。 CXF (Celtix + XFire)是一个开源的Services框架。CXF 帮助您利用 Frontend 编程 API 来构建和开发 Services ,像 JAX-WS 。这些 Services 可以支持多种协议 ...
分类:
Web程序 时间:
2017-04-17 20:34:28
阅读次数:
585
这是一篇关于纯C++RPC框架的文章。所以,我们先看看,我们有什么? 1、一个什么都能干的C++。(前提是,你什么都干了) 2、原始的Socket接口,还是C API。还得自己去二次封装... 3、C++11,这是最令人兴奋的。有了它,才能够有这篇文章;否则,CORBA之类的才是唯一的选择。(因为需 ...
分类:
其他好文 时间:
2017-04-16 23:10:20
阅读次数:
272
一、背景介绍 CORBA\DCOM\RMI等RPC中间件技术已经广泛应用于各个领域,但是面对规模和复杂度都越来越高的分布式系统,这些技术慢慢显现出局限性: 同步通信:客户发出调用后,必须等待服务完成处理并返回结果后才能继续执行; 客户端和服务端的生命周期密切耦合;客户进程和服务对象进行必须都正常运行 ...
分类:
其他好文 时间:
2017-03-29 01:05:56
阅读次数:
199
一、需要的jar包 spring.jar commons-loggin.jar commons-loggin.jar commons-annotation.jar 二、项目结构 三、entity 四、dao 五、service 六、beans.xml 七、测试 八、效果 @Component:类似把 ...
分类:
编程语言 时间:
2017-02-28 22:34:12
阅读次数:
200
RMI,即RemoteMethodInvoke(远程方法调用)。RMI最初在1.1被引入Java平台中,它为Java开发者提供了一种强大的方法来实现Java程序间的交互。在RMI之前,对于Java开发者来说,远程调用的唯一选择是CORBA或者手工编写Socket程序。关于RMI框架的基本原理如下图:
分类:
其他好文 时间:
2017-02-25 21:51:39
阅读次数:
172
网络通信引擎(Internet Communications Engine, Ice)是由ZeroC的分布式系统开发专家实现的一种高性能、面向对象的中间件平台。它号称标准统一,开源,跨平台,跨语言,分布式,安全,服务透明,负载均衡,面向对象,性能优越,防火墙穿透,通讯屏蔽。因此相比CORBA,DCO ...
分类:
其他好文 时间:
2017-01-22 15:11:44
阅读次数:
200
这是一篇关于纯C++RPC框架的文章。所以,我们先看看,我们有什么? 1、一个什么都能干的C++。(前提是,你什么都干了) 2、原始的Socket接口,还是C API。还得自己去二次封装... 3、C++11,这是最令人兴奋的。有了它,才能够有这篇文章;否则,CORBA之类的才是唯一的选择。(因为需 ...
分类:
其他好文 时间:
2017-01-07 18:14:57
阅读次数:
201
向接口(Northbound Interface)提供给其他厂家或运营商进行接入和管理的接口,即向上提供的接口。 其是驻留在底层网管上的一个进程,与通常所说的Agent功能相同。负责处理来自上层网管的请求报文,发送trap信息。经常简写为“Intf.N” 一般网管提供三种北向接口,分别为CORBA( ...
分类:
其他好文 时间:
2017-01-03 20:53:51
阅读次数:
162
《深入篇》我们主要围绕 RPC 的功能目标和实现考量去展开,一个基本的 RPC 框架应该提供什么功能,满足什么要求以及如何去实现它? RPC 功能目标 RPC 的主要功能目标是让构建分布式计算(应用)更容易,在提供强大的远程调用能力时不损失本地调用的语义简洁性。为实现该目标,RPC 框架需提供一种透 ...
分类:
其他好文 时间:
2016-11-27 06:41:22
阅读次数:
216